27-361. Common system of drainage; contribution
of cost


A. When adjacent or contiguous mines, opened, developed and worked upon the same or
upon separate lodes have a common ingress of water, or, by reason of subterranean
communication of water, have a common drainage, the operators of the mines shall provide
for disposal of their proportionate share of the drainage, or to prevent the water in the
mine from flowing in or upon neighboring mines.


B. If an operator of such mines fails or neglects to provide for drainage, and by
reason of failure or neglect the operator of an adjacent or contiguous mine is compelled
to pump, drain or otherwise provide for the water flowing in from the other mine, the
operator of the mine in default shall be liable for the proportion of the actual and
necessary cost and expense of pumping, draining or otherwise providing for such water.
